1. Discrete Energy Levels in Atoms | 原子的分立能级
According to the Bohr model, electrons can only exist in certain allowed orbits around the nucleus. Each orbit corresponds to a specific energy level. The lowest energy state is called the ground state (n=1). Higher energy states (n=2, 3, …) are called excited states. Electrons are not allowed to have energies between these discrete levels; they must jump from one level to another and cannot linger in between.

The energy of an electron in a given level is usually measured in electronvolts (eV) and is negative, indicating that the electron is bound to the nucleus. The ground state has the most negative energy. If the electron gains exactly +13.6 eV for hydrogen, it becomes free (ionisation).

2. The Photon Model and Energy of a Photon | 光子模型与光子能量
When an electron falls from a higher energy level (E₂) to a lower energy level (E₁), it emits a photon whose energy exactly equals the difference in energy: ΔE = E₂ – E₁. Because the energy levels are quantised, only certain photon energies are possible, producing a line spectrum rather than a continuous one. The photon energy is related to its frequency f and wavelength λ by

E = h f
E = h c / λ
where h is Planck’s constant (6.63 × 10⁻³⁴ J s) and c is the speed of light. In Edexcel questions, you are often required to convert between joules and electronvolts using 1 eV = 1.60 × 10⁻¹⁹ J. Setting up the equation correctly and handling unit conversions are crucial skills.

3. Emission Spectra | 发射光谱
An emission spectrum is produced when excited atoms return to lower energy states and emit photons. Each element has a unique set of energy levels, so the emitted photons produce a pattern of bright lines on a dark background – a characteristic line emission spectrum. This can be observed by passing light from a gas discharge tube through a diffraction grating or prism.

For hydrogen, the visible lines belong to the Balmer series, where electrons drop from n > 2 to n = 2. The red line (Hα) corresponds to a transition from n = 3 to n = 2, blue-green (Hβ) from n = 4 to n = 2, violet (Hγ) from n = 5 to n = 2, and the series limit corresponds to the ionisation energy from n = 2.

Exam questions may ask you to draw a labelled energy level diagram showing arrows for specific photon emissions. Clearly mark energy values in eV, indicate the ground state, and show the direction of electron transitions (downward arrows for emission).

4. Absorption Spectra | 吸收光谱
An absorption spectrum is produced when white light passes through a cool gas. Electrons in the gas atoms absorb photons of specific energies to jump to higher levels. The transmitted spectrum then shows dark lines on a continuous background at precisely the wavelengths that have been absorbed. The dark lines correspond exactly to the bright lines in that element’s emission spectrum because the same energy differences are involved.

For example, the Sun’s spectrum contains dark Fraunhofer lines caused by absorption from elements in its outer atmosphere. In the lab, you can produce an absorption spectrum by passing light from a filament lamp through sodium vapour; two prominent dark lines appear at the familiar sodium D-line wavelengths.

Key exam point: Photon absorption only occurs if the photon energy exactly matches the gap between two energy levels. If the photon energy is too low or too high, it will not be absorbed, and the photon will pass through unchanged. This explains why the spectrum shows dark lines rather than a general dimming.

5. The Hydrogen Atom and Energy Level Equation | 氢原子与能级方程
For hydrogen, the energy of the nth level (in eV) is given by:
Eₙ = –13.6 / n² eV
This equation is provided in the Edexcel data booklet. n is the principal quantum number (n = 1, 2, 3, …). The ground state energy is –13.6 eV. The negative sign means energy must be supplied to remove the electron.

The difference between two levels is:
ΔE = 13.6 (1/nᵢ² – 1/nƒ²) eV
where nᵢ is the initial level and nƒ is the final level, and nᵢ > nƒ for emission. Note the sign carefully: ΔE positive for emission (energy released), negative for absorption (energy absorbed by the electron).

To find the wavelength of the emitted photon, first calculate ΔE in eV, convert to joules by multiplying by 1.60 × 10⁻¹⁹, then use λ = hc / ΔE. Alternatively, combine into a single formula using the Rydberg constant, but Edexcel typically expects step-by-step calculation using the energy level equation.

6. Fluorescence and Energy Level Transitions | 荧光与能级跃迁
Fluorescence occurs when a material absorbs high-energy (typically ultraviolet) photons, exciting electrons to high energy levels. The electrons do not return directly to the ground state; instead, they ‘cascade’ down through intermediate levels, emitting several lower-energy photons in the visible range. For example, fluorescent tubes use UV light to excite a phosphor coating, which then glows with visible light.

The emitted photons always have less energy than the absorbed photon because some energy is lost as heat during the intermediate steps. This means the emitted light has a longer wavelength than the absorbed light – a phenomenon known as the Stokes shift. In exams, you might have to calculate the energy difference if given wavelengths, or explain why the material appears a certain colour.

Compare fluorescence with phosphorescence: in phosphorescence, the excited electrons get trapped in metastable states, and the emission continues for some time after the exciting source is removed. This is not explicitly required for Edexcel Physics but can appear as extension context.

7. Spectral Series of Hydrogen | 氢原子光谱线系
Hydrogen shows several spectral series depending on the final energy level:
- Lyman series: transitions to n = 1 (ultraviolet region).
- Balmer series: transitions to n = 2 (visible and near-UV).
- Paschen series: transitions to n = 3 (infrared).
- Brackett series: transitions to n = 4 (far infrared).
- Pfund series: transitions to n = 5 (far infrared).
The Balmer series is the most commonly examined because four lines are visible. You must be able to identify transitions from energy levels to n = 2 and calculate corresponding wavelengths.

| Transition (n→2) | Name | Colour | Wavelength (approx.)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 3 → 2 | H-alpha | Red | 656 nm |
| 4 → 2 | H-beta | Cyan (blue-green) | 486 nm |
| 5 → 2 | H-gamma | Violet | 434 nm |
| 6 → 2 | H-delta | Deep violet | 410 nm |
Questions often ask for the Balmer series limit: this occurs when an electron is captured from infinity (n = ∞) into n = 2, giving the shortest possible wavelength for this series (≈ 364 nm, just into the ultraviolet).

8. Ionisation and the Hydrogen Energy Level Diagram | 电离与氢原子能级图
The ionisation energy is the minimum energy required to remove an electron from the ground state of an atom. For hydrogen, this is 13.6 eV. In an energy level diagram, ionisation corresponds to the electron leaving the atom, reaching an energy of 0 eV (from negative values). The vertical arrow is drawn from the ground state up to the 0 eV line (sometimes labelled as n = ∞).

If an electron already is in an excited state, less energy is needed to ionise the atom. For example, an electron in n = 3 needs only 13.6 / 3² = 1.51 eV to be freed. This is often examined by giving a diagram and asking “How much energy is required to ionise an electron from level X?” or “Identify the transition that produces the most energetic photon.”

Note: The energy values are always negative for bound electrons. The highest energy transition (shortest wavelength) is the one with the largest energy difference. In emission, that means from the highest excited level down to the ground state, or to the lowest possible final state.

9. Experimental Methods for Observing Spectra | 观察光谱的实验方法
You should be able to describe the use of a diffraction grating to observe an emission spectrum. Light from a discharge tube is collimated into a narrow beam, passed through a diffraction grating, and the resulting diffraction pattern is viewed on a screen or through a spectrometer. The angle θ for each spectral line is related to the wavelength by the grating equation:
d sinθ = nλ
where d is the grating spacing (1 / number of lines per metre), n is the order of the maximum, and λ is the wavelength. By measuring θ, you can calculate the wavelength of the spectral line.

For absorption spectra, a continuous white light source is placed behind the sample. The light is then analysed with a grating or prism. Exam questions may ask you to explain why a specific colour filter or gas would produce dark lines at certain positions when inserted.

10. Common Exam Pitfalls and Calculations | 常见考试陷阱与计算
Pitfall 1: Forgetting to convert electronvolts to joules before using E = hc/λ. Always multiply eV by 1.60 × 10⁻¹⁹. If the energy difference is given in eV directly, convert it first. Alternatively, you can memorise that hc = 1.99 × 10⁻²⁵ J m, but the safest approach is to keep units consistent.

Pitfall 2: Confusing emission and absorption transitions. Emission arrows point DOWN, and the photon energy equals the positive difference. Absorption arrows point UP. In an absorption question, you may be told the wavelength of an absorbed photon and asked to identify the transition; use the energy to find the initial and final n.

Pitfall 3: Assuming the lines in a spectrum are evenly spaced. In hydrogen, the lines become closer together as they approach the series limit, because the energy levels get closer as n increases. A typical exam graph asks you to sketch the emission spectrum and comment on the spacing.

Calculation example: An electron drops from n = 4 to n = 2 in hydrogen. Find the wavelength emitted. Using Eₙ = –13.6/n², E₄ = –0.85 eV, E₂ = –3.40 eV, so ΔE = 2.55 eV. In joules: 2.55 × 1.60 × 10⁻¹⁹ = 4.08 × 10⁻¹⁹ J. Then λ = hc / ΔE = (6.63 × 10⁻³⁴ × 3.00 × 10⁸) / (4.08 × 10⁻¹⁹) ≈ 4.88 × 10⁻⁷ m = 488 nm, which matches the H-beta blue-green line. Always show full working.

11. Applications of Atomic Spectra | 原子光谱的应用
Atomic spectra are used in astronomy to determine the chemical composition of stars and galaxies. By identifying the dark absorption lines in a star’s spectrum, scientists can deduce which elements are present in its outer layers. The redshift or blueshift of these lines, due to the Doppler effect, also reveals the star’s motion relative to Earth – a key piece of evidence for the expanding universe.

In the laboratory, flame tests produce characteristic colours because the heated metal atoms emit photons of specific wavelengths. For example, sodium gives a yellow-orange doublet (589.0 nm and 589.6 nm), lithium gives red, and copper gives green-blue. You can use a simple spectroscope to observe these and relate them to the atom’s unique energy level gaps.

Understanding energy levels also underpins laser operation. A population inversion is created so that stimulated emission dominates, producing coherent monochromatic light. While detailed laser physics is not the focus here, the concept of stimulated emission depends on matching photon energy to an energy gap – exactly the same principle.

12. Exam Strategy and Key Equations Summary | 考试策略与关键公式总结
In Edexcel exams, you may encounter multiple-choice questions, short-answer calculations, and long descriptive questions linking energy levels to spectra. Always: (1) write down the relevant equation from the data booklet; (2) convert units carefully; (3) show each step, including intermediate energy values in eV; (4) for descriptive questions, use precise language such as ‘discrete energy level’, ‘photon energy equals the difference between levels’, and ‘characteristic line spectrum’.
在爱德思考试中,你可能遇到选择题、简答计算题以及将能级与光谱联系起来的描述性长答题。始终做到:(1)从公式表中写出相关方程;(2)仔细转换单位;(3)展示每一步,包括以 eV 为单位的中间能量值;(4)在描述性题目中使用精确的语言,如“分立能级”、“光子能量等于能级差”和“特征线状光谱”。
Essential equations to memorise (also available in the Edexcel data booklet):
- E = h f
- E = hc / λ
- 1 eV = 1.60 × 10⁻¹⁹ J
- Hydrogen energy: Eₙ = –13.6 / n² eV
- Grating equation: d sinθ = nλ
Be ready to rearrange these to find any variable. In particular, when given a grating spacing and observed angle, you can find wavelength and then use photon energy to identify the element or energy level transition.
